Go to Inventory, Devices, and use the View By, Label, and choose the label. Select all the devices, then click the Choose Action drop-down and click on Remove Labels. Select the label (there may be more than one, only remove this one) you wish to remove, then click the Remove Labels button.
Tips on Making and Mounting Location Labels Your labels should be durable and fixed in place (i.e., dont use magnets or labels that can be easily moved). Labels should be easy to read, preferably from across a room. Consider using easy-to-spot colors such as black on yellow or white on red.
Label Each Box On More Than One Side As you put items into their boxes or bins, write the contents of the box on at least one side and the top of the box. If you can, use a dark permanent marker and white sticky labels. It will make them easier to read if they stand out.
How to Create Good Inventory Item Descriptions Most important: Inventory item descriptions should begin with a noun (what the item is) followed by the adjectives that describe the item (in descending order of the adjectives importance). Inventory item descriptions should be unique.
Inventory tags are stickers placed on equipment to make their identification process easier. These tags contain codes or identification numbers allotted to a particular item, its details, location, and related information.
Each shelf should be properly labeled, usually with a numbering system starting with the lowest number from the floor, and ascends to the top shelf. Position specific location each shelf or level is segmented in.
